Sugar is a vital ingredient in food recipes, providing the essential taste of sweetness that enhances the flavor of countless dishes. Found in many of our daily foods and drinks, sugar is an omnipresent component of modern cuisine. By definition, sugar is a sweet crystalline or powdered substance, white when pure, consisting of sucrose obtained mainly from sugar cane and sugar beets. It is used in various foods, drinks, and even medicines to improve their taste.
In culinary terms, sugar delivers one of the primary taste sensations—sweetness. This sensory appeal makes sugar a staple in baking, confectionery, and beverage production. The process of making sugar involves extracting juice from sugar cane or beets, filtering, concentrating, and purifying it until sugar crystals form. The result is the white sugar commonly used in households and food industries.
Beyond its role in cooking, sugar plays a crucial biological function. Simple sugars, or monosaccharides like glucose, store energy that biological cells use and consume. These sugars are fundamental to metabolism and energy production in living organisms. In ingredient lists, sugars are often identified by names ending in "ose," such as glucose, fructose, and sucrose.
Despite its benefits, the excessive consumption of sugar is linked to health issues like obesity, diabetes, and heart disease. Therefore, while sugar is indispensable for its flavor and energy-providing properties, it should be consumed in moderation to maintain a balanced diet and good health.
